Product Update - September 06, 2026
My Tasks Bulk Actions — bulk delete, start, and set due dates for tasks
Individual tasks can now be deleted directly from the three-dot menu on the task card, Kanban view, and detail panel — without navigating to the Manage board. On the List view, a new checkbox column and select-all control let users bulk-start tasks, bulk-set a due date, or bulk-delete in one step. The action confirms how many tasks were affected and how many were skipped, so users always know what changed. Recurring tasks support deleting the entire series at once. Permission rules are consistent with the Manage board: task authors and admins can delete; workspace to-dos and other users' assignments are protected.
Use case: A team lead clears completed personal tasks at the end of the week by selecting all and choosing Delete — instead of opening each task individually.
Available in: Tasks → My Tasks → List View
Leave Management Payroll Reconciliation Report — cross-employee, cross-leave-type payroll reconciliation
Previously, reconciling paid leave for a pay period meant opening the Bank Statement one employee and one leave type at a time. A new Payroll Reconciliation tab in Leave Compliance Reports shows every employee in scope as a single row, with one column per leave type showing approved paid hours, unpaid hours, hours pending approval, and closing balance — all in one view. A summary card at the top totals across all employees; the footer row sums every column. Clicking any cell drills into that employee's Bank Statement filtered to the same leave type and range, so figures are always consistent between the two reports. The report exports to CSV with a TOTAL row and supports date-range, location, and leave-type filters. Built for large tenants: page loads in under a second and a full CSV for tens of thousands of employees completes in a few seconds.
Use case: A payroll administrator reconciling a bi-weekly pay period exports a single spreadsheet showing every employee's approved leave hours by type — no manual aggregation needed.
Available in: Leave Management → Compliance Reports → Payroll Reconciliation
AI Notes Notification Control — per-user control over "meeting notes ready" notifications
When AI Notes finishes processing a meeting, it sends an inbox notification to the meeting owner. Users who attend many meetings found this noisy but had no reliable way to turn it off — the preference existed in the desktop client but was not being read, so the notification fired regardless. This preference is now honoured: when a user turns it off, no notification is sent. A new web toggle ("Notify me when my notes are ready" / "Stop 'notes are ready' messages") appears in the More menu on the AI Notes meetings list, so web users can manage the setting without leaving the app. The existing per-category control under Account Settings → Notifications remains available for users who want to manage all AI Notepad notifications together.
Use case: A manager who attends 8–10 meetings a day turns off "notes are ready" notifications from the meetings list, keeping their inbox focused on items that need action.
Available in: AI Notes → Meetings → More menu → Notification preference
